Is Music A Ritual?

Is Music A Ritual? Indeed, ‘ritual’ and ‘performance’ are in many ways synonymous. Music is often conceived as a medium for the transformation of boundaries between the sacred and the profane, and the natural and supernatural, probably because of the roles that it fulfils in that respect in many societies’ rituals. How Did Secular Music Change In The Renaissance?

How Did Secular Music Change In The Renaissance? In the Renaissance, music became a vehicle for personal expression. Composers found ways to make vocal music more expressive of the texts they were setting. Secular music absorbed techniques from sacred music, and vice versa. Popular secular forms such as the chanson and madrigal spread throughout Europe.

What Are Some Characteristics Of Spiritual Songs?

What Are Some Characteristics Of Spiritual Songs? As an example of the folk culture process, spirituals were composed and developed communally over a period of time. Often mournful and elegiac, the lyrical content of spirituals frequently articulate a desire for both spiritual salvation and personal freedom. What is an example of spiritual music?
